This is my second cruise and my first on RCCL. My family chose RCL because they were cheaper and had heard so many good things about them. We live in New York and the cruise was out of Fort Lauderdale and went to St. Thomas, St. Maarten and Nassau. We sailed in the second to last week of August 2001.

On the day of the cruise we flew from Kennedy Airport to Fort Lauderdale- Hollywood Airport. We arrived at the airport at about 1:00. We met the RCL agent.....well she had a sign that said EOS....we first went to the wrong one because it was the explorer of the seas.....we met the lady and she told us to sit down and fill out our forms...and she got a wheelchair for my grandmother who walks with a cane and was very tired. Filing out the forms occupied most of our time. We finished and got on a little bus. There were too man people so some of them waited for another one to come. We got to the terminal at about 1:45 p.m. When we arrived it looked like everyone was already on the ship. Embarkation was a breeze. There was no one there. We where on the ship within 15 minutes. They man helping us was so nice....but he was trying to persuade my aunt into letting me get a charge card...she kept saying no...he kept saying "u sure???"...i kept saying "please???":( ..........it was funny to me at least.)

We then got on our ship and went to our stateroom on Deck 4. (Ocean View with 2 beds and 2 pullmans) We went to the lifeboat drill and it was hot and sticky and muggy... It took such a long time. When I went on the Destiny it did not take as long as this one did. While we where at the lifeboat drill, i noticed i could not spot one single kid besides my cousin and I. I panicked....We went back to the stateroom and we were looking at the t.v. when I realized the ship was moving.....They could have made an announcement, at the least. So we ran to the top deck and I got the camcorder and was filming when I realized I was in the back of the ship....Unlike Carnival it doesn't have the big smokestack to differentiate.
